Quarterly Planning Note — Divestiture of the Coastal Tooling Unit

For the finance team: the sale of the Coastal Tooling unit to Pellmark Industries remains on track for close in Q3. Please finalize the carve-out balance sheet, reconcile intercompany positions, and prepare the working-capital adjustment schedule by month-end. Audit support requests should be prioritized. For planning purposes, note the following sensitive item:

internal memo for hawef-kahif: The finance team signed off on a budget of $25.9 million for Project Sorox. The renewal with Pelokek Logistics closes at $51.7 million a year, 52 percent below the last contract.

### Step 7: Enable Log Compaction on Quernstream

Before enabling compaction on the Quernstream queue, confirm that retained records contain no plaintext secrets, since compaction preserves the latest value per key indefinitely rather than expiring it. Compaction runs as the broker service account; verify its permissions are scoped to the data directory only. Once the review passes, apply the settings and restart brokers one at a time. The compaction configuration to apply is the following.

deployment values, bafog-tajop:
NOVAEL_PIN=7103
NOVAEL_TENANT=weneth
NOVAEL_METRICS_HOST=metrics.novael.crelvocorp.corp
NOVAEL_SEAL=seal_be72a3d3
NOVAEL_STANDBY_TEAM=caseth

For the board. The Helvora division requests incremental funding to accelerate the Bramwick tooling upgrade and hire six engineers. Management assesses the request as justified: current throughput constraints risk missing committed volumes to key accounts. Offsetting savings have been identified in facilities spend at the Norfell site. Recommendation: approve with quarterly milestone reviews. Context on how this request aligns with broader strategy appears in the confidential note below.

confidential, bahap-bajog: Zorethix Works is in early talks to buy Kelethox Foods for about $30.7 million. The Ralvan launch date is September 19, and nothing goes to the press before then.